Summary Summary of gene provided in NCBI Entrez Gene.
The MAPEG (Membrane Associated Proteins in Eicosanoid and Glutathione metabolism) family includes a number of human proteins, several of which are involved the production of leukotrienes. This gene encodes an enzyme that catalyzes the first step in the bi

Protein name Leukotriene C4 synthase (LTC4 synthase) (EC 4.4.1.20) (Glutathione S-transferase LTC4) (EC 2.5.1.-) (Leukotriene-C(4) synthase) (Leukotriene-C4 synthase)
Protein function Catalyzes the conjugation of leukotriene A4 with reduced glutathione (GSH) to form leukotriene C4 with high specificity (PubMed:23409838, PubMed:27365393, PubMed:27791009, PubMed:7937884, PubMed:9153254). Can also catalyze the transfer of a glut
